Geospatial and statistical analysis of under-five and neonatal mortality rates in Eastern African Community(EAC) using R # EAC Mortality Analysis This project presents a geospatial and temporal analysis of under-five and neonatal mortality rates across countries in the East African Community (EAC). The analysis leverages data visualization and mapping techniques in **R** and abit of **Python** to highlight regional disparities and trends over time. ## 📊 Project Objectives - Visualize and compare **Under-Five Mortality Rate** and **Neonatal Mortality Rate** across EAC countries. - Create **choropleth maps** using individual shapefiles to show the most recent data. - Analyze **trends over time** for each mortality indicator. - Identify countries with the **highest mortality rates** in the latest year. ## 🌍 Countries Included - Burundi - Democratic Republic of the Congo - Kenya - Rwanda - Somalia - South Sudan - Uganda - United Republic of Tanzania ## 🛠️ Tools Used - `R`, `ggplot2`, `sf`, `dplyr`, `viridis` - GADM country shapefiles (Level 0 boundaries) - Custom R functions for plotting and summarization ## 🔍 Insights - Temporal plots reveal a general **decline in mortality** across most EAC countries. - Choropleths highlight **geographic disparities**, with some countries persistently exhibiting higher rates. - Identified the countries with the **highest current mortality burdens**, informing where targeted health interventions may be needed most. ## 🚀 How to Run 1. Clone the repo: ```bash git clone github.com ``` 2. Open `jimmy_Mugendi.RMD` in RStudio. 3. Ensure all dependencies are installed: ```r install.packages(c("sf", "tidyverse", "ggplot2", "viridis")) ``` 4.
